比特币作为一种去中心化的加密货币,其安全性一直是用户关注的焦点。多重签名技术是确保比特币交易安全性的重要方式之一。本文将深入探讨比特币钱包中的多重签名技术,解释其工作原理、优缺点以及使用场景。同时,我们将解答一些常见问题,例如如何设置多重签名钱包、其对交易速度的影响,以及与传统钱包的比较等。
什么是多重签名技术?
多重签名技术(Multisignature 或 Multisig)是指在比特币交易过程中,需要多个私钥进行交易授权的机制。这种方法提高了比特币交易的安全性,降低了单点故障的风险。简单来说,用户可以将其比特币钱包设置为需要多人签名才能进行交易,这对于企业或合伙人之间的资金管理尤为重要。
传统的比特币钱包只需要一个私钥进行交易确认,若这个私钥被泄露或者丢失,导致钱包资金面临风险。那么,多重签名钱包的设置则可以要求多个不同的私钥进行交易,通过设定规则(如2-of-3),使得即使一部分私钥泄露,资金依然是安全的。
比特币钱包多重签名的工作原理
多重签名钱包的基本设定通常由两个部分组成:生成多个密钥及设置签名方案。用户可以创建多个密钥(如通过不同的设备或用户)并制定签名条件:
- 例如,2-of-3的模式要求三个密钥中的任意两个密钥进行交易确认。
- 或者设置为3-of-5的模式,任意三个密钥签名才能完成交易。
对于多重签名的功能,用户通常需要使用支持这种技术的钱包软件。在生成比特币地址时,钱包会将生产的公钥组合成一个新的地址,这个地址即为多重签名地址。只有符合条件的私钥持有者才能进行资金的转移。这一过程可以极大提高交易的安全性。
多重签名钱包的优势与劣势
多重签名的钱包在比特币的使用中具有明显的优势,包括:
- 增强安全性:由于需要多个私钥进行交易,它减少了单个私钥被盗或丢失的风险。
- 灵活的资金管理:企业中的多个成员可以共同管理资金,避免个别成员擅自支配资金。
- 防止错误交易:在提出资金移动的建议时,可以通过其他成员进行审核和确认。
然而,多重签名钱包也并非没有缺点:
- 复杂性:设置和管理多重签名钱包相对复杂,初学者可能很难掌握。这需要一定的技术知识。
- 交易速度多重签名的确认过程需要多个私钥的参与,这可能导致交易速度较慢。
- 恢复若所有持有私钥的用户都丢失了私钥,资金将无法找回,因此在管理上需要非常谨慎。
如何设置多重签名钱包?
设置多重签名钱包的过程虽然比较复杂,但以下是一些关键步骤:
- 选择一个支持多重签名的钱包服务:首先,用户需要选择一个支持多重签名功能的钱包,有很多钱包都提供这一功能,包括硬件钱包和软件钱包。
- 生成多个公私钥对:用户在钱包中生成相应数量的公私钥对(例如 3 对),这些是参与签名的账户。
- 建立多重签名地址:根据所需的签名规则(如2-of-3)组合公钥生成多重签名地址。
- 测试钱包功能:设置完成后,可以进行小额交易测试,以验证多重签名功能是否正常。
在选择多重签名钱包时,用户还应考虑其功能性、用户体验和资金安全等多个因素。
多重签名钱包对交易速度的影响
多重签名钱包在一定程度上可能会影响交易速度。这主要体现在交易的确认时间上:
- 多重签名确认:与单签名钱包相比,进行交易时需要获取多个私钥的签名,这会增加所需的时间。例如,在一个2-of-3的设置中,用户须要联系另两位持有者,获取他们的签名进行确认。
- 网络拥堵:在比特币网络繁忙时,多重签名交易可能需要等待更长时间才能被确认。这是因为每笔交易都需在链上进行验证。
- 交互复杂性:由于管理多个密钥,需要所有参与者都在线并检查钱包,这可能会使得一些交易需要更长的时间来执行。
因此,用户在选择多重签名钱包时,应该充分考虑交易速度及其影响。
与传统比特币钱包的比较
与传统比特币钱包相比,多重签名钱包具有一些显著的差别:
- 安全性:传统钱包依赖单一私钥进行资金管理,泄露或丢失将导致资金风险。多重签名钱包通过多个私钥分散风险。
- 管理结构:传统钱包通常由一个个人或单个组织控制,而多重签名钱包适合团队或机构间的财务管理,提升了透明度和信任度。
- 复杂性:传统钱包的使用相对简单,只需记住一组私钥。而多重签名钱包需要了解如何管理多个私钥和建立签名规则,存储和备份的复杂性提高。
总的来说,选择适合自己需求的钱包类型是极其重要的,用户应根据实际情况进行合理的选择。
常见问题解答
- 如何设置多重签名钱包?
- 多重签名钱包对交易速度的影响?
- 多重签名钱包的优势与劣势是什么?
- 与传统比特币钱包的比较是什么?
综上所述,多重签名钱包在比特币的安全管理中扮演着重要角色,通过合理的设置与使用,用户可以大大降低资金被盗或丢失的风险。尽管存在某些劣势,但在特定的管理场景下,多重签名钱包无疑是提升安全的有效工具。
leave a reply